Skip to content
29 Jan – 8 Feb 2026

Lee Man-Hee

More information will follow soon.

Lee Man-Hee at IFFR

  • A Triangular Trap

    Lee Man-Hee | 85' | South Korea | None

    Three men menace an unfortunate heiress in one of the last, recently restored thriller dramas made by the productive Lee Man-hee before his premature